Delivering high-precision servo control, optimized bus communication, and rigid structural mechanics for zero-defect automation.
Utilizes fully integrated AC servo motors across all main and auxiliary axes. Achieves sub-millimeter repeating positioning accuracy (±0.02mm) suited for rapid take-out, high-density IML (In-Mold Labeling), and insert molding applications.
Engineered around high-speed EtherCAT and CANopen fieldbus architectures. Real-time control loops ensure instant communication between the robot manipulator, mold protection sensors, and downstream conveyor networks.
Cross-beams crafted from high-tensile structural steel combined with custom aerospace-grade aluminum alloy arms minimize structural vibration during high-speed take-out operations down to 0.6 seconds.
| Model Category | Applicable IMM Tonnage | Payload Capacity (kg) | Drive System | Take-out Time (sec) | Primary Industrial Applications |
|---|---|---|---|---|---|
| WKG-1000 3-Axis Single Arm | 100T – 250T | 3.0 – 5.0 kg | Full AC Servo System | 0.8 – 1.2s | Standard daily consumer products, thin-wall food containers |
| WKG-1500 Bullhead Series | 250T – 450T | 10.0 – 15.0 kg | High-Torque AC Servo | 0.9 – 1.5s | Automotive interior components, home appliance housings |
| WKFI-950 5-Axis Double Arm | 250T – 600T | 5.0 – 8.0 kg (Dual Arm) | 5-Axis Synchronous Servo | 0.6 – 1.0s | Precision medical devices, complex multi-cavity precision molds |
| Heavy-Duty Heavy-Tonnage Servo Robot | 1200T – 2300T | 25.0 – 50.0 kg | Heavy AC Servo + Direct Reducers | 1.8 – 3.0s | Automotive bumpers, large logistics pallets, industrial containers |

ODM (Original Design Manufacturing) manipulators are engineered around your specific mold geometry, factory clearance constraints, and cycle requirements. Unlike rigid off-the-shelf robots, an ODM solution optimizes the stroke lengths, axis acceleration parameters, and End-Of-Arm Tooling (EOAT) to trim critical micro-seconds off every cycle while preserving mold safety.
Zhiyi manipulators incorporate hardware-level interlock signals connected to the injection molding machine's Euromap 12 or Euromap 67 interface. Additionally, real-time current/torque detection algorithms identify minor physical resistance (such as a stuck part) within 5 milliseconds, instantly freezing robot movement to prevent mold damage.
